Besleti Bridge
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 2.5.
The Besleti Bridge also known as Queen Tamar's Bridge is a medieval arched stone bridge at Sukhumi, Georgia’s breakaway republic of Abkhazia. Located some 6 km from the city centre, the bridge spans the small mountain River Besletka, and dates back to the late 12th century. Besleti Bridge is situated 3½ km north of Kelasuri Cave.
Bagrat Fortress
Photo: Halavar,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Bagrat's Castle is a ruined medieval castle near Sokhumi, Georgia’s breakaway republic of Abkhazia, close to the Black Sea coast. It is named after the Georgian king Bagrat, either Bagrat III or Bagrat IV, and traditionally dated to the late 10th or 11th century. Bagrat Fortress is situated 3 km west of Kelasuri Cave.
Kelasuri Wall
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Kelasuri Wall or Great Abkhazian Wall is a stone wall located to the east of Sokhumi in Abkhazia, Georgia. The exact time of its construction is not known; several dates ranging from antiquity to the 17th century were suggested, although more recent works have provisionally favoured construction in the 6th century AD. Kelasuri Wall is situated 4 km south of Kelasuri Cave.

Abzhanda
Village
Linda or Ülem-Linda is a village in Abkhazia, Georgia. The village was established by Estonians in 1884. It had a school and a prayer house. Due to the War in Abkhazia the village was hit particularly hard due to its proximity to Sukhumi. Abzhanda is situated 3 km north of Kelasuri Cave.
